Farewell to a Legend: Mike Enriquez’s Iconic Broadcasts We’ll Always Remember

Aug 30, 2023   •   Edgardo Toledo

Yesterday, news of the passing of veteran journalist and 24 Oras news anchor Mike Enriquez shook the country. He was a significant part of our everyday lives, delivering news and bold commentaries with unmatched vigor. But he also made our way into our hearts with his on-air wit and humor. Let’s look back at some of his finest and most amusing moments we’ll never forget. 

 

Mike Enriquez, award-winning broadcast journalist and rapper

Aside from filling our nightly news fix, Enriquez proved in this 24 Oras episode that he was more than just an award-winning broadcast journalist — dude had bars! Take it from this clip and watch how he nailed the 24 Oras’ iconic closing spiel like a true MC!

 

Who’s who?

Even a seasoned news anchor like Enriquez isn’t safe from on-air bloopers. And with all the news presenters that have graced the 24 Oras studio, it’s understandable why he briefly confused himself with fellow 24 Oras anchorman Ivan Mayrina. Nonetheless, it was a moment that brought a hearty giggle!

 

Wait, what?

In yet another episode of Mike Enriquez bloopers, the 24 Oras anchorman faced quite a challenge in pronouncing what we believe to be “Magkakalagitnaan na ng Mayo.” But hey, all of us experience bad days.

Sabong panlasa…?

Who would’ve imagined that news on rising suggested retail prices (SRPs) of everyday commodities could turn into a lighthearted TV moment? Speaking of which, Enriquez knows a news report or two, like the time he got into a mumbo jumbo, going from “sabong” to “sabong panlasa,” before finally nailing “sabong panlaba” (laundry detergent).

 

Excuse me po!

The COVID-19 pandemic has been a stressful time for countless Filipinos. While reporting about the new COVID-19 strains, Enriquez made us laugh when he accidentally coughed on air. In classic Mike Enriquez humor, he assured viewers it’s not COVID-19, and they’ve got nothing to worry about.

“Excuse me po! Hindi po ‘yun coronavirus,” Enriquez quipped.

 

The Payatas Tragedy

We’re all familiar with the “Mike Enriquez” we see in 24 Oras. But I believe Sir Mike’s finest moments were those when he reported on the field. Here’s his coverage of the Payatas Tragedy. Enriquez reported on devastating situations throughout the 54 years of his journalism career. But even in the face of the most distressing moments, his unwavering dedication to delivering the news never wavered. Enriquez’s fearless coverage of the Payatas Tragedy stands as a testament to why he was one of the pillars of Philippine broadcast media.

 

A fearless journalist through and through

“Fearless” is one of the many words that best describes Enriquez. During the 2019 senatorial elections, he didn’t hesitate to speak on behalf of millions of Filipinos, who were likely intending to ask this question to the then-senatorial candidates: What’s next?

“Ngayon pa lang, magkaalaman na. Para habang umuusad ang kanilang termino, nache-check natin ‘yung ginagawa nila versus ‘yung ipinangako nila,” he stated.

We’ll miss hearing his brave statements on TV and radio!

 

Our Imbestigador ng Bayan

Before we were binge-watching true crime on streaming sites, GMA’s long-time-running investigative docudrama show Imbestigador was already dominating the airwaves. Led by Enriquez, it was a staple of our Saturdays, filled with crime reports, entrapment operations, and dramatizations. Enriquez is Imbestigador. The iconic line “Hindi namin kayo tantanan!” will forever resonate in our minds.
